在导航到其他页面时阻止按钮双击,可以通过以下几种方式实现:
document.getElementById("buttonId").disabled = true;
这样,按钮将变为不可点击状态,直到页面导航完成后再启用按钮。
document.getElementById("buttonId").addEventListener("click", function() {
// 禁用按钮
this.disabled = true;
// 延迟一段时间后启用按钮
setTimeout(function() {
document.getElementById("buttonId").disabled = false;
}, 1000); // 延迟1秒
});
这样,按钮在点击后会被禁用1秒钟,防止用户连续点击。
document.getElementById("buttonId").addEventListener("click", function() {
// 显示加载状态
this.innerHTML = "加载中...";
// 导航到其他页面
window.location.href = "otherPage.html";
});
这样,按钮在点击后会显示"加载中..."的文本,给用户一个反馈,同时导航到其他页面。
以上是几种常见的阻止按钮双击的方法,具体选择哪种方式取决于你的需求和设计。在实际开发中,可以根据具体情况选择适合的方式来阻止按钮双击。
领取专属 10元无门槛券
手把手带您无忧上云